1965 DKW F 11 vs. 1986 Lamborghini LM002

To start off, 1986 Lamborghini LM002 is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 DKW F 11.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 DKW F 11 would be higher. At 5,167 cc (12 cylinders), 1986 Lamborghini LM002 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1986 Lamborghini LM002 (420 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 386 more horse power than 1965 DKW F 11. (34 HP @ 4300 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1986 Lamborghini LM002 should accelerate faster than 1965 DKW F 11.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1986 Lamborghini LM002 weights approximately 1962 kg more than 1965 DKW F 11.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1986 Lamborghini LM002 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1965 DKW F 11.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1986 Lamborghini LM002 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1986 Lamborghini LM002 (500 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 429 more torque (in Nm) than 1965 DKW F 11. (71 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 1986 Lamborghini LM002 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1965 DKW F 11.

Compare all specifications:

1965 DKW F 11 1986 Lamborghini LM002
Make DKW Lamborghini
Model F 11 LM002
Year Released 1965 1986
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 796 cc 5167 cc
Engine Cylinders 3 cylinders 12 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 34 HP 420 HP
Engine RPM 4300 RPM 6800 RPM
Torque 71 Nm 500 Nm
Torque RPM 2500 RPM 4500 RPM
Engine Bore Size 68 mm 85.5 mm
Engine Stroke Size 68 mm 75 mm
Drive Type Front 4WD
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 730 kg 2692 kg
Vehicle Length 3970 mm 4910 mm
Vehicle Width 1580 mm 2010 mm
Vehicle Height 1450 mm 1860 mm
Wheelbase Size 2260 mm 3010 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 31 L 169 L
